Edin Dzeko: 'We can't reach our top level in Europe'

Manchester City striker Edin Dzeko says that he doesn't know why the club have underperformed in the Champions League.

Edin Dzeko has admitted that he is unsure why Manchester City have struggled in the Champions League.

The Premier League holders are yet to win in the group stages of this season's tournament and could be knocked out if they lose their next match against Bayern Munich.

"It's difficult to say what's the problem, you know, because we had some great games in the Champions League, but for some reason we can't reach our top level — how we play in the Premier League — and we definitely have to work on it and try to learn how to play against teams in Champions League," he told Bleacher Report.

"When you think it will be easy, it's not; it's never easy there."

Man City's remaining Group E fixtures will see them host Bayern on November 25, before travelling to the Stadio Olimpico to face Roma on December 14.
